After everything was settled, Cheng Xiao Xiao handed the event back over
to Old Man Ying, who continued with the auction of the race. Cheng Xiao Xiao
walked back to the seat prepared for her by the servant and sat down.
“Xiao Xiao, did you run into any incidents on your trip to look for the
iron-armed bear?” Cheng Biyuan wasn’t concerned about the auction and asked his
daughter softly.
Cheng Xiao Xiao lifted the corners of her mouth and smiled, “Dad, I am
perfectly fine right here, aren’t I? An iron-armed bear won’t be able to hurt
me.”
Ever since it was born, Cheng Xiao Xiao was the first human the
iron-armed bear had encountered. There was no memory of in it of human
slaughtering mystical beasts so he had no animosity toward her.
Cheng Xiao Xiao hadn’t expected the should-be-irritable giant bear to
not attack either and just like that, the human and the bear locked eyes for
the longest time before they started communicating with each other.
After communicating through her spiritual senses, she noticed that the
sentient iron-armed bear has the intelligent roughly of a 3-year-old child and
it didn’t know much. Other than the instinct to cultivate and look for food, it
didn’t much thoughts or memories on its mind.
So Cheng Xiao Xiao pulled out the tricks that one would use on a child
to lure it into her dimension. Once the iron-armed bear had entered the
dimension, the thick mystical qi made the bear even happier. It liked
the place; not only did it have other sentient mystical beasts, it also have
Yuteng, the fairy. The bear, who had always been lonely in the deep parts of
the mountain, was mesmerized entirely.
Cheng Xiao Xiao easily lured the little bear into the dimension and had
no urgency to rush home. She made another round in the mountain and collected
several other types of herbs before she
slowly headed home.
Cheng Biyuan didn’t take his daughter’s words seriously. He didn’t think
it’d be so easy to tame a level-7 mystical beast. He only said softly, “As long
as you are alright!”
The conversation between the father and daughter weren’t loud but
everybody seated heard them clearly. Everybody had different thoughts from the
dialogs yet they all have the same look on them – a deep cautiousness.
“Oh, right, Xiao Xiao. This is the dean of School of Divine Condor, he
saved my life once!”
Hearing her father’s introduction, she who had a bad impression of those
from School of Divine Condor frowned slightly. But when she heard that he had
saved his father once, her expression finally softened and she nodded at the
old man and cupped her hands at him, “Junior is Cheng Xiao Xiao. Greetings,
Dean!”
“The maiden of the Cheng’s was alright. You are already a martial
spiritualist at your young age. You are certainly as talented as your father
little BIyuan!” said the dean with a tender look.
Cheng Xiao Xiao’s look stiffened for a bit. This was the first time she
heard someone referring to her father as “little BIyuan”, she couldn’t help but
felt curious about his age, “How old are you, Dean?”
“Xiao Xiao!” Cheng Biyuan objected. His daredevil daughter was probably
the only one who’d ask the dean his age point blank.
The dean did not think much of it; contrarily, he quite appreciate Cheng
Xiao Xiao’s forwardness and speak what was on her mind.
“I am around 300 years old, young lady. Do you now agree that I can
refer to your father as ‘little Biyuan’?”
“Ugh…..”
Cheng Xiao Xiao was speechless!
Three hundred years old! That was enough to witness the rise and fall of
an entire era. Yes, he was indeed old enough.
He also shared his level of cultivation. The old man was also a martial emperor,
but without breaking through to the next level, a 300-something year old
martial emperor wouldn’t have too much time remaining.
